Exhaust Emission Control System
The exhaust emission control system includes
the following components that should not
need adjustment, although periodic inspection
by your dealer is recommended.
Z
Secondary Air Injection System
The secondary air injection system adds
filtered air into the exhaust gas to help improve
emission control performance.
Evaporative Emission Control System
An evaporative emissions control system uses
a canister filled with charcoal to adsorb fuel
vapor from the fuel tank and carburetor while
the engine is off. The vapor is drawn into the
engine and burned while riding.
Emission Control Systems
Crankcase Emissions Control System
The positive crankcase ventilation system
prevents gases that build up in the engine’s
crankcase from being released into the
atmosphere. The gases are drawn into the
engine and burned while riding.
Fuel Permeation Emission Control
The fuel tank, fuel hoses, and fuel vapor
charge hoses use fuel permeation control
technologies to prevent fuel vapor emissions.
Tampering with these components to reduce
or defeat the effectiveness of the fuel
permeation technologies is prohibited.
